Transistor-Plus technology uses a plastic Fresnel lens to concentrate sunlight onto a proprietary, high-performance silicon vertical multi-junction solar cell. The proprietary vertical multi-junction solar cell (VSC) is a rugged high-voltage and low series resistance concentrator solar cell with vertical junctions and contacts providing near optimum current collection without sheet resistance, current crowding and blockage of illumination. The vertical cell requires far less silicon than conventional cells, which should help minimize price fluctuations due to silicon price volatility. In addition, the design can improve high-voltage output for small solar cell dimensions, a feature that makes this device attractive for many applications where other designs are impractical. Transistor-Plus vertical solar cells can be manufactured in commercial semiconductor foundries, commonly used in sectors such as the computer chip industry. This allows better use of excess foundry capacity without having to invest heavily in new custom-built equipment. As a result, Transistor-Plus’s proprietary technology can be put into mass production quicker and with lower capital expenditures than any other solar-electric technology. |
